1. Technical Configurations and Plant Typology
A modern Chinese stone crusher plant is a sophisticated production line far removed from simple standalone crushers. Its design follows a systematic flow: Feeding → Primary Crushing → Secondary Crushing → Tertiary Crushing (if needed) → Screening → Conveying → Storage & Loading.
- Primary Crushing Stage: Jaw crushers are almost universally employed here for their robustness and high reduction ratio. Chinese manufacturers like SBM, Liming Heavy Industry (Lvssn), and Zhejiang MP have perfected the design of PE/PEX series jaw crushers, offering models with capacities from 50 to over 1500 tons per hour (tph). Heavy-duty apron or vibrating feeders ensure consistent material flow into the primary crusher.
- Secondary & Tertiary Crushing: Cone crushers are the standard for secondary crushing due to their ability to produce well-shaped medium-sized aggregates. Hydraulic adjustment and clearing systems—once exclusive to Western brands—are now standard on mid-to-high-end Chinese models (e.g., single-cylinder and multi-cylinder hydraulic cone crushers). For finer shaping and sand production (manufactured sand or M-sand), impact crushers (horizontal shaft) or vertical shaft impact (VSI) crushers are integrated. The adoption of VSI crushers highlights the industry’s shift towards meeting high-quality sand specifications for modern concrete.
- Screening & Automation: Multiple-deck vibrating screens (linear or circular motion) are critical for classifying crushed material into precise fractions (e.g., 0-5mm, 5-10mm, 10-20mm). The most significant technological leap in recent years is the integration of Programmable Logic Controller (PLC)-based automation systems. These systems monitor motor loads, conveyor speeds, and bin levels, allowing for central control room operation, optimization of production flow, and early fault detection.
- Mobility & Flexibility: Beyond stationary plants, China leads in manufacturing mobile and portable crushing plants. Track-mounted jaw/cone/impact crusher combinations provide exceptional flexibility for contract crushing, mining sites with phased development, and construction waste recycling at demolition sites.
2. Market Drivers and Industrial Ecosystem
The proliferation of Chinese stone crusher plants is fueled by powerful domestic and international forces.
- Domestic Demand: China’s decades-long infrastructure boom—encompassing highways, high-speed rail networks, urban development (“sponge cities”), and massive hydropower/energy projects—has created an insatiable demand for aggregates. This internal market provided the initial scale for manufacturers to invest in production facilities and R&D.
- Complete Industrial Chain: China possesses a uniquely integrated supply chain. From steel casting (mantles, concaves) and heavy machining (shafts, housings) to electric motor manufacturing and control panel assembly, nearly all components are sourced domestically. This vertical integration drastically reduces costs and shortens delivery times.
- Policy & Environmental Shifts: Stringent environmental regulations have forced the industry to upgrade. Modern plants are now required to be equipped with comprehensive dust suppression systems (water sprays at transfer points) and fully enclosed structures with baghouse filter systems to capture particulate matter. Furthermore,the national push for construction waste recycling has spurred innovation in mobile plants designed specifically for processing concrete rubble.
3. Competitive Advantages: Deconstructing the “Cost-Performance” Proposition
The global appeal of Chinese stone crusher plants rests on several pillars:
- Price Competitiveness: This is the most apparent advantage. Lower labor costs economies of scale in component production translate into final plant prices typically 30% to 50% lower than equivalent Western European or North American offerings.
